
浮点数
答案:C++中推荐使用std::to_string进行数字转字符串,简洁安全;对于格式化需求可用stringstream或高性能fmt库,避免使用不安全的C风格函数。
C++11引入用户定义字面量,通过operator""定义带下划线后缀的自定义处理函数,支持整数、浮点数、字符串等类型,实现如5_km表示公里、3.5_s表示秒的直观语法,提升代码...
本教程详细介绍了如何使用Pandas库将一个DataFrame中的多列数据(如昵称)映射到目标DataFrame的单列中,并进行其他必要的列数据转换(如性别缩写),最终与另一个DataFrame进行合...
答案:PHP中进行除法需注意除数不为零并确保类型正确。应使用/运算符计算,通过条件判断避免除零错误,结合set_error_handler捕获异常,用filter_var验证数据类型,并以floatv...
std::to_chars和std::from_chars提供高效无异常的数值与字符串转换,适用于高性能场景。它们直接操作预分配缓冲区,避免内存分配与异常开销,支持整数和浮点数的精确格式化及解析,并通...
本教程详细介绍了如何使用PHP从包含逗号作为小数分隔符的文本中精确提取数值(如价格),并将其转换为可用于数学计算的浮点数。文章首先指出标准过滤函数的局限性,然后通过正则表达式preg_replace进...
PHP支持加减乘除等基本算术运算,适用于整数和浮点数,运算中需注意浮点精度问题及类型自动转换,建议使用round函数或BCMath扩展处理高精度计算。
调整PHP配置可提升数学运算精度与性能:1.修改precision=20以增加小数位输出;2.启用BCMath扩展进行高精度计算,使用bcadd等函数;3.安装并启用GMP扩展处理大整数运算;4.避免...
PHP中可通过number_format、round和sprintf控制浮点数精度:number_format用于格式化输出,如number_format(3.14159,2)得"3.14&...
答案:C++中处理字节序需检测平台字节序并按需转换,使用htonl等函数或自定义swap_endian进行整数转换,结构体和浮点数应序列化为统一字节序,避免直接内存拷贝,确保跨平台数据一致性。